Transaction 730317a29afc0b16fafa46ce84186c9cb15c3f4adfafb8fd56a4a00fcb112e0a

1 Input
2 Outputs
  • 730317a29afc0b16fafa46ce84186c9cb15c3f4adfafb8fd56a4a00fcb112e0a:0
  • value  18900555
    address  3FVkWoWhMRyWRmdEEb84C11xcLHqvwrg5D
  • 730317a29afc0b16fafa46ce84186c9cb15c3f4adfafb8fd56a4a00fcb112e0a:1
  • value  21558759
    address  12Ch7xdV7SkdUhomsMALu4G2x1Yk5YtNxT